  1. Does Sierra Leone have an autonomous sanctions list?
    No.

  2. What is the name of Sierra Leone’s sanctions list?
    Sierra Leone does not maintain an autonomous sanctions list.

  3. Who maintains Sierra Leone’s sanctions list?
    N/A

  4. Does Sierra Leone adhere to UN sanctions?
    Yes, Sierra Leone implements UN sanctions.

  5. Does Sierra Leone implement any other international sanctions regimes?
    No.
